Police appeal after hit and run crash in South Woodford that put motorcyclist in hospital
Police are appealing for information after a hit and run crash in South Woodford last weekend.
Officers were called to the eastbound carriageway of the A406 between the Waterworks Corner and Charlie Brown’s Roundabout around 11.30am on Sunday August 4.
The car and motorcyclist had collided and the driver of the car failed to stop at the scene.
The motorcyclist, a man in his 40s, was taken to an east London hospital with a suspected broken leg. He has since been discharged.
Police are trying to trace the car, which was described as dark coloured.
